Transaction fa7700583d2b151d96a6d2e1be504f77be91ee6e6ab3ddc9deb5cb109b0eae86
1 Input
2 Outputs
- fa7700583d2b151d96a6d2e1be504f77be91ee6e6ab3ddc9deb5cb109b0eae86:0
- fa7700583d2b151d96a6d2e1be504f77be91ee6e6ab3ddc9deb5cb109b0eae86:1
value 3599370
address 3NbHJFWC7QJyB5ze8hzJbMquKPE8miRYaY
value 15670883
address 37X6RwpwGjSETFFYUTArNN2JbmKbeQS1Ni